It is with heavy hearts that we mourn the loss of Portland City Commissioner Nick Fish.

“As a trusted public servant, champion for Public Parks and member of the Square’s Board, Commissioner Fish’s impact on Portland will benefit all Portlanders for generations far into the future,” says Ron Stewart, President of Pioneer Courthouse Square Board of Trustees.

Our thoughts and condolences are with his family, friends, loved ones and staff.
